Blessed are the Poor in Spirit: those Emptied and Unloaded to Receive from the Lord

December 29, 2025 by aGodMan 9 Comments

Blessed are the poor in spirit, for theirs is the kingdom of the heavens. Matt. 5:3

We need to be poor in spirit, emptied and unloaded in our human spirit, so that we may realise and possess the kingdom of the heavens; this means we need to be humble, acknowledging that we have nothing, know nothing, can do nothing, and are nothing, so we need the Lord’s filling desperately.
